Las principales empresas de desarrollo de aplicaciones tienen que considerar el deseo de los consumidores de tener contenido nuevo. Una de las áreas de enfoque son las noticias. Todos leen las noticias en sus dispositivos móviles. Si el dispositivo o la aplicación desde la que las personas obtienen una noticia no funciona bien, el usuario puede buscar formas alternativas de acceder a las noticias.
Google se dio cuenta de esto y ha optimizado la visualización de noticias en su navegador móvil y dispositivos con AMP. Los editores pueden usar AMP para distribuir su contenido más rápidamente en dispositivos móviles que mediante métodos tradicionales. De esta manera, sus noticias son fácilmente accesibles para los usuarios móviles, lo que lo convierte en una mejor opción. Los desarrolladores de aplicaciones pueden optimizar sus aplicaciones de manera similar. Aquí hay algunas sugerencias:
1. Añadir un Feed de Noticias a la Aplicación
Añadir un feed de noticias es una forma de optimizar las aplicaciones para el contenido. Un feed de noticias proporciona acceso a las últimas noticias de fuentes confiables. Los usuarios pueden ver fácilmente los últimos titulares. Si el feed de noticias está enlazado, los usuarios pueden ir al sitio web y ver la historia completa. Las empresas de desarrollo de aplicaciones crean aplicaciones con características similares.
Los desarrolladores de aplicaciones pueden seleccionar las fuentes para el feed de noticias. También podrían permitir a los usuarios seleccionar fuentes de una lista. Se podría añadir una opción que implique ingresar manualmente una fuente para el feed de noticias. Esto optimizaría instantáneamente la aplicación para noticias.
Cada vez que el usuario abriera la aplicación, los últimos titulares aparecerían en la parte superior de la misma. Estos se actualizarían regularmente. Un feed de noticias haría que la aplicación fuera más útil para el usuario, y la usarían más a menudo si obtuvieran buena información de la aplicación.
2. Ofrecer Compras Dentro de la Aplicación para Contenido
Otra opción es añadir contenido para comprar dentro de la aplicación. Esto incluye suscripciones a artículos y noticias. La aplicación también podría ofrecer historias como recompensa por completar tareas. Esto es ideal para aplicaciones de juegos. La mayoría de las aplicaciones de juegos ofrecen recompensas de nivel básico. Las empresas de desarrollo de aplicaciones podrían hacer el juego más maduro incluyendo recompensas más interesantes, como historias interesantes o tramas secundarias.

También podría haber extractos de revistas interesantes o libros de referencia. El texto histórico siempre vale la pena leerlo.
Una aplicación que incluya más contenido es generalmente más interesante. Si el contenido está disponible para su compra en una aplicación, se convierte en una fuente de contenido, y es probable que los usuarios acudan a la aplicación en busca de contenido en lugar de a las fuentes tradicionales. Pronto, las aplicaciones podrían ser la principal fuente de entretenimiento, noticias y juegos.
3. Mostrar Contenido Orientado a Temas y Blogs
Una aplicación de juegos deportivos podría mostrar clips deportivos populares, como las mejores jugadas de la semana o momentos famosos de la historia del deporte. Los jugadores podrían subir sus grabaciones de videojuegos a la comunidad en línea, y la aplicación podría mostrar los videos más populares en la pantalla de inicio de la aplicación. Las empresas de desarrollo de aplicaciones podrían usar ideas similares para hacer que la aplicación esté más impulsada por el contenido. Los usuarios abrirían la aplicación para ver los últimos videos. Otra idea es mostrar las últimas fotos tomadas por los usuarios. Esta es una buena idea para aplicaciones de fotos.
Mantener un blog para la aplicación es otra forma de promocionar contenido o usar el contenido como un medio para atraer usuarios. El blog podría presentar artículos interesantes, imágenes y videos. Los temas estarían relacionados con la aplicación. Cuando los usuarios estén aburridos con la aplicación, o si el usuario no quiere actualizar la aplicación, podrían leer el blog y publicar comentarios.
4. Opciones para Compartir Integradas en las Aplicaciones
La mayoría de las aplicaciones tienen botones de redes sociales para compartir. Estos incluyen Facebook, Twitter e Instagram. También hay otras formas de compartir cosas, como por correo electrónico, mensajes de texto y Bluetooth. Para enviar información a través de estos métodos, las empresas de desarrollo de aplicaciones tendrían que incorporar opciones para compartir. Estas permitirían a los usuarios copiar fácilmente direcciones web del navegador y enviarlas a contactos por correo electrónico o mensaje de texto. Aparecería una ventana mostrando todas las aplicaciones disponibles para enviar información y los usuarios podrían seleccionar una para usar.
5. Opciones para Compartir por NFC
Los teléfonos Android tienen una función para compartir que utiliza NFC. Se llama Android Beam y se utiliza para transferir archivos de un teléfono a otro. Esto puede ser útil para muchas aplicaciones, especialmente las de cámara. Los usuarios pueden compartir fotos entre sí cuando se encuentran, o pueden compartir códigos de juegos. También es una excelente manera de dar y recibir listas de compras. En el lado del contenido, los usuarios pueden compartir texto escaneado y artículos. Por ejemplo, los usuarios pueden fotografiar páginas de un libro o revista y compartirlas por NFC.

Un requisito para compartir por NFC es que el archivo debe estar en el almacenamiento externo. Las empresas de desarrollo de aplicaciones necesitarían programar los siguientes pasos:
- Solicitar Permiso
- Nombrar la Función NFC
- Nombrar la Transferencia Android Beam
- Prueba de Compatibilidad para la Transferencia de Archivos
- Nombrar los Archivos a Enviar
- Crear una Técnica de Llamada de Vuelta (Callback) que Entregue los Archivos
6. Programación para Compartir Archivos
Otra forma de compartir contenido es configurando el intercambio de archivos dentro de la aplicación. Esto implica usar un URI de contenido. Los URI de contenido son generados por FileProvider. FileProvider es parte de la Biblioteca de Soporte v4. La ventaja de esto es que la información de una aplicación puede ser accedida y utilizada por otra aplicación. Para hacer esto, el desarrollador de aplicaciones tendría que hacer lo siguiente:
- Especificar el FileProvider
- Especificar los Directorios Compartibles
Para especificar el FileProvider para una aplicación, haz una entrada en el manifiesto. Esto especificará la autoridad requerida para generar URI de contenido. También identificará el archivo XML, que proporcionará los directorios que son compartibles por la aplicación. Al especificar la autoridad para una aplicación, usa un valor con el siguiente texto ‘fileprovider’ adjunto. El elemento <provider /> revelará el directorio a compartir. Usa un atributo para el nombre y la ruta del archivo; la extensión .xml no está incluida.
El siguiente paso es especificar los directorios. Para hacer esto, crea un archivo llamado ‘filepaths.xml’ en el subdirectorio res/xml/. Añade un elemento XML para cada directorio. Esto permitirá que el almacenamiento interno de la aplicación comparta los directorios.

Kenneth Evans es un Estratega de Marketing de Contenidos para Top App Development Companies, una plataforma de investigación para las principales empresas de desarrollo de aplicaciones del mundo. Ha contribuido a varias plataformas y foros de blogs.